About The Position

Chamberlain Group is a global leader in access solutions, with brands like LiftMaster, Chamberlain, Merlin, and Grifco, providing smart access solutions through the myQ digital ecosystem. The company hires smart people to work on cool products for a connected world. The internship program offers real, meaningful projects central to the business strategy and company transformation. It includes development and skills training through workplace success sessions, networking events with interns and full-time employees, mentorship from a full-time employee, Q&A sessions with the CEO and other leaders, and community giving volunteer outings. As a Software Engineering Intern within CGI’s Engineering group, you will gain hands-on experience building and supporting modern, AI-powered applications while working alongside experienced engineers on real-world projects. This full-time, on-site (hybrid) internship opportunity from late May to August 2026 in Oak Brook, IL, is ideal for a rising senior passionate about Generative AI. You will contribute to the development of AI-driven features such as intelligent assistants, automation tools, and middleware services, learning best practices in modern software engineering. The internship offers an opportunity to apply academic and personal project experience using LLMs, AI coding assistants, and contemporary development tools in a professional environment through collaboration, mentorship, and exposure to Agile development.
